Summary
- Invesco CurrencyShares British Pound Sterling Trust filed a Pre-Effective Amendment No. 2 on Form S-1 to change the EDGAR tag of the registration statement from S-3/A to S-1/A.
- The Trust issues British Pound Sterling Shares (Shares) that represent units of fractional undivided beneficial interest in, and ownership of, the Trust.
- Invesco Specialized Products, LLC is the sponsor of the Trust.
- The Bank of New York Mellon is the trustee of the Trust, and JPMorgan Chase Bank, N.A., London Branch is the depository.
- The Trust intends to issue additional Shares on a continuous basis through the Trustee.
- Shares may be purchased from the Trust only in one or more blocks of 50,000 Shares, called a Basket.
- Each Basket is offered and sold to an Authorized Participant at a price in British Pounds Sterling equal to the net asset value (NAV) of 50,000 Shares.
- The Shares are listed and trade on NYSE Arca under the symbol FXB.
- The investment objective of the Trust is for the Shares to reflect the price in USD of the British Pound Sterling.
- The Sponsor's fee accrues daily at an annual nominal rate of 0.40% of the British Pounds Sterling in the Trust and is paid monthly.
- The Trust will terminate on June 8, 2046, if it has not been terminated prior to that date.

Risks
- Fluctuations in the price of the British Pound Sterling could materially and adversely affect the value of the Shares.
- Economic, political, or financial events can impact the British Pound Sterling/USD exchange rate.
- If interest earned by the Trust does not exceed expenses, the Trustee will withdraw British Pounds Sterling, reducing the amount represented by each Share.
- The interest rate paid by the Depository may not be the best rate available.
- The Shares may trade at a price above or below the NAV per Share.
- Disruptions in the ability to create and redeem Baskets may adversely impact the price of the Shares.
- Substantial sales of British Pounds Sterling by the official sector could adversely affect an investment in the Shares.
- International Armed Conflicts May Result in Volatility in Currency Prices that Could Adversely Affect the Funds Performance.
- Pandemics and other public health emergencies could disrupt the global economy and adversely impact the Trusts performance.
- Changes to United States tariff and trade policies may increase the volatility of foreign exchange rates.
- Shareholders do not have the protections associated with ownership of shares in an investment company registered under the Investment Company Act of 1940.
- Shareholders do not have the rights enjoyed by investors in certain other financial instruments.
- If the Depository becomes insolvent, its assets may not be adequate to satisfy a claim by the Trust or any Authorized Participant.
- The License Agreement with The Bank of New York Mellon may be terminated by The Bank of New York Mellon in the event of a material breach.
- Shareholders may incur significant fees upon the termination of the Trust.
- The Depository owes no fiduciary duties to the Trust or the Shareholders, is not required to act in their best interest and could resign or be removed by the Sponsor, which would trigger early termination of the Trust.
- Redemption orders are subject to rejection by the Trustee under certain circumstances.
- The liability of the Sponsor and the Trustee under the Depositary Trust Agreement is limited and, except as set forth in the Depositary Trust Agreement, they are not obligated to prosecute any action, suit or other proceeding in respect of any Trust property.
- The Depositary Trust Agreement may be amended to the detriment of Shareholders without their consent.
- Due to the increased use of technologies, intentional and unintentional cyber attacks pose operational and information security risks.

Industry Context
This filing relates to an exchange-traded fund (ETF) that provides investors with exposure to the British Pound Sterling. The ETF structure offers a regulated and transparent way to invest in a foreign currency, which can be an alternative to traditional foreign exchange markets or currency futures.
Comparison to Industry Standards
- The Invesco CurrencyShares British Pound Sterling Trust (FXB) is comparable to other currency ETFs such as the Invesco CurrencyShares Euro Trust (FXE), Invesco CurrencyShares Australian Dollar Trust (FXA), and similar funds that track other individual currencies.
- The expense ratio of 0.40% is within the typical range for currency ETFs, although some competitors may have slightly lower or higher fees.
- The structure as a grantor trust is common for currency ETFs, providing a direct link to the underlying currency and avoiding the use of derivatives.
- The use of authorized participants for creation and redemption of shares is a standard mechanism for ETFs to maintain market efficiency and track the underlying asset's value.
